About MESH
MESH Robotics Construction is automating rebar fabrication and construction processes using robotics and software. Our mission is to bring modern robotics and industrial-grade automation to one of the most fragmented and under-invested industries enabling faster safer and more precise construction through systems that integrate seamlessly into existing workflows.
We design and deploy robotic solutions that operate in harsh real-world production environments not labs or demos. Our work spans mechanical systems robotics software and industrial automation with a strong focus on robustness simplicity and deployability.
MESH is based in Switzerland with in-house workshops and robot testing facilities. We work closely with partners across the construction and machinery ecosystem and regularly test our systems in production and on-site environments. We value close collaboration and hands-on engineering and primarily work on-site with our hardware.
